工程零件数据库管理系统:如何构建高效、可扩展的零件信息管理平台
在现代制造业和工程设计领域,零件是构成复杂系统的核心单元。无论是汽车制造、航空航天还是电子设备生产,工程零件的种类繁多、规格各异,其数据管理直接影响研发效率、供应链协同与质量控制。因此,建立一个结构清晰、功能完善、安全可靠的工程零件数据库管理系统(Engineering Parts Database Management System, EPDMS)已成为企业数字化转型的关键一步。
一、为什么要建设工程零件数据库管理系统?
传统上,企业依赖Excel表格、纸质档案或分散的文件夹存储零件信息,这种方式存在诸多弊端:
- 数据冗余与不一致:同一零件在不同部门可能有多个版本,导致设计冲突或采购错误。
- 查找效率低下:工程师需花费大量时间在无序文档中搜索所需零件参数。
- 版本控制混乱:缺乏变更记录机制,难以追溯历史版本和审批流程。
- 无法支持协同开发:跨地域团队难以实时共享最新零件库。
而一套专业的EPDMS能够集中管理所有零件数据,实现标准化录入、权限控制、版本追踪与智能检索,显著提升研发效率与产品质量。
二、核心功能模块设计
一个成熟的工程零件数据库管理系统应包含以下核心功能模块:
1. 零件基础信息管理
这是系统的基石,包括零件编号、名称、分类(如标准件、非标件)、材料、尺寸、重量、图纸链接等字段。建议采用主键唯一性约束确保每个零件唯一标识,并支持批量导入(如CSV/Excel)和API接口对接CAD软件(如SolidWorks、AutoCAD)自动提取参数。
2. 版本控制与生命周期管理
零件从设计→试制→量产→停产的全过程必须被记录。系统应提供版本号(V1.0、V1.1等)、变更日志、审批流(如设计工程师→工艺工程师→质量主管)等功能。通过Git式版本树展示历史差异,便于回溯与审计。
3. 权限与角色管理
基于RBAC(Role-Based Access Control)模型,设置不同角色的访问权限。例如:设计人员可编辑自己的零件,但不能删除;采购员只能查看可用供应商列表;管理层可生成报表并导出数据。
4. 智能搜索与筛选
支持模糊查询(如输入“螺栓”即可匹配所有相关零件)、高级筛选(按材质、公差等级、适用行业等)、标签分类(如#机械加工 #不锈钢 #M6)。结合Elasticsearch或Solr引擎,可实现毫秒级响应。
5. 与PLM/MES/ERP系统集成
EPDMS不是孤立存在的,它需要与产品生命周期管理系统(PLM)、制造执行系统(MES)及企业资源计划系统(ERP)打通。例如:当零件入库时,自动触发ERP库存更新;当新版本发布时,通知PLM进行设计评审。
三、技术架构选型建议
构建EPDMS的技术栈需兼顾稳定性、扩展性和易维护性:
1. 数据库层
推荐使用PostgreSQL或MySQL 8.0+作为关系型数据库,因其支持JSON字段、全文索引、事务一致性,适合存储结构化零件数据。对于图纸、BOM表等非结构化内容,可用MongoDB或对象存储(如AWS S3)配合元数据表管理。
2. 应用服务层
后端建议采用Spring Boot(Java)或Django(Python),提供RESTful API接口供前端调用。若追求微服务架构,可用Kubernetes部署各子模块(如用户服务、零件服务、权限服务)。
3. 前端界面
推荐Vue.js + Element UI 或 React + Ant Design 构建响应式Web界面,支持PC端和移动端访问。可视化图表(如零件数量趋势图、版本分布饼图)有助于决策分析。
4. 安全与备份策略
实施HTTPS加密传输、JWT身份认证、SQL注入防护。定期备份数据库至异地服务器,并启用增量备份减少停机时间。
四、典型应用场景举例
场景1:新产品开发阶段
设计师在系统中快速检索已有标准件(如轴承、齿轮),避免重复设计;同时上传新零件图纸并提交审核,系统自动提醒相关人员处理,缩短研发周期约30%。
场景2:供应链协同优化
采购部门通过EPDMS查看某零件当前供应商状态(是否缺货、是否有替代品),并与ERP联动下单,降低断料风险。
场景3:质量追溯与合规管理
一旦发现某批次零件质量问题,可通过系统一键定位该零件的所有使用记录、设计版本、检验报告,符合ISO9001、IATF16949等行业标准要求。
五、常见挑战与应对策略
在实际落地过程中,企业常面临以下挑战:
1. 数据迁移困难
旧系统数据格式杂乱,需制定清洗规则(如统一单位制、去除空值)。可借助ETL工具(如Apache NiFi)自动化转换。
2. 用户接受度低
部分工程师习惯手动操作,可通过培训+激励机制(如积分奖励)引导使用。初期可设置过渡期,允许双轨运行。
3. 扩展性不足
随着业务增长,系统可能面临性能瓶颈。建议预留水平扩展能力(如分库分表)、引入缓存(Redis)加速高频读取。
六、未来发展趋势
随着AI和工业互联网的发展,EPDMS也将演进为更智能的平台:
- AI辅助设计推荐:基于历史数据推荐相似零件,减少重复劳动。
- 数字孪生集成:将零件数据与虚拟仿真模型绑定,用于预测失效风险。
- 区块链溯源:确保关键零件来源可信,尤其适用于军工、医疗等领域。
总之,一个高效的工程零件数据库管理系统不仅是信息化基础设施,更是企业知识资产沉淀与创新能力建设的重要支撑。它让每一个零件都有“身份证”,也让每一次设计都更加精准可靠。





